Housing in Ann Arbor costs 4.3ร— the median income, below the national average of 4.5ร—. The median home price is $360K and median rent is $1,451/month. Ann Arbor ranks #176 of 373 metros for affordability.

Note: ZORI reflects current listing prices and may differ from the Census ACS median rent shown above, which captures what renters actually pay including below-market and subsidized units.
